1. HP 27-inch FHD Monitor
Brand | HP |
Refresh Rate | 75 Hz |
Screen Surface Description | Flat |
Max Screen Resolution | 1920 x 1080 Pixels |
Product Dimensions | 17.21 x 23.93 x 7.4 inches |
If you are on the hunt for the best monitor for MacBook pro under 300, HP 27inches with Full High-Definition Display can be your perfect pick. Beautiful looks, a good brightness ratio, and a high refresh rate of 75hz make it a brilliant choice for gamers and digital content creators.
HPs typically have attentive screens with a frameless profile and IPS panel that has genuinely stood out. The HP 27 FHD is undoubtedly on the list of those seeing for a gaming display monitor and the list of thinnest monitors for your MacBook pro.
The colors of HP 27 FHD have a lot to offer. Luckily, HP engaged a strong focus on display with 99% sRGB color gamut coverage for next-level color accuracy and consistency, one of their best-selling features.
Besides the alluring beauty, this monitor from HP also does not dissatisfy in terms of connecting ports, transporting the expected for its category: 2x HDMI 1.4 and 1x VGA port. The USB type C is a great add-on for charging and fast data transferring.
The HP 27 inches FHD also has a robust brightness ratio of 300 nits. This isn’t a significant change from 250, but it’s one of the belongings that sets this screen apart from the rest of the market and makes the content look lifelike and realistic on the big screen.
The monitor also features AMD Free Sync to keep the display flawless for watching or working on videos containing fast-action scenes. The technology keeps every scene precise and full of details for better understanding. Hence, it is a great external screen for Mac devices, except the lack of built-in speakers might make you think twice about purchasing.

2. SAMSUNG UE57 Series 28-Inch Monitor
Brand | SAMSUNG |
Refresh Rate | 60 Hz |
Screen Surface Description | Smooth |
Max Screen Resolution | 3840×2160 Pixels |
Product Dimensions | 26.01 x 7.36 x 18.44 inches |
Samsung always sets the standard high with all of their products, including monitors, soundbars, and TVs, and this 28-inch monitor with 2160p resolution is no exception. With AMD Free Sync and 1 ms response time, it will make a great second screen for the MacBook pro. Moreover, the flicker-free technology and eye saver mode promote extended working hours with the monitor.
Its overall look and built-in specs are very prepared and attractive. Its lovely design and flawlessly engineered framework will add to the attractiveness of your working desk or gaming setup. Besides your gaming table system, you can choose this monitor for your workstations as it will add value to your productivity despite your working nature.
The outer body of this display has a matte finish surrounded by a metallic frame to ensure strength so that the monitor develops more durable and long-lasting. The VESA compatibility allows hassle-free mounting on the station. Besides, the stand of this monitor is so steady, but it gives an exaggerated look that feels attractively good. The foot or immoral of the frame is very much negligible.
This monitor has a TN board that does not do too well. We associate it with the other VA panels and in-plane switching IPS display pixel kinds. So, the Samsung series has got thin viewing angles that worsen the image quality and the color-shifting when you see it also from the right or the left side of the display.
On the upside, the picture-by-picture function boosts productivity by letting you split the screen and get multiple works done in a blink. Decent connectivity options, including HDMI and Display port, allow you to effortlessly connect laptops, PCs, MacBook pro, and other peripherals with the stable connection property.
